数控车床G33编程,作为数控编程中的一个重要功能,可以实现循环切削,提高加工效率和精度。以下将从专业角度详细解析数控车床G33编程的步骤和方法。
G33编程的核心在于设置循环切削的起点、终点、半径以及循环路径。以下是G33编程的详细步骤:
1. 确定循环切削的起点和终点:需要确定循环切削的起点和终点,这两个点决定了循环切削的范围。在编程时,可以使用G90指令设置绝对编程模式,然后使用G17、G18或G19指令选择X、Y或Z轴的平面进行循环切削。
2. 设置循环切削的半径:循环切削的半径是指从起点到终点的距离。在编程时,可以使用G98或G99指令来设置循环切削的半径。G98指令表示循环切削的半径为负值,即从终点向起点切削;G99指令表示循环切削的半径为正值,即从起点向终点切削。
3. 编写循环切削路径:在确定了起点、终点和半径后,接下来需要编写循环切削的路径。循环切削路径通常包括以下步骤:
a. 调整刀具位置:使用G00指令将刀具移动到循环切削的起点位置。
b. 设置切削深度:使用G43或G44指令设置刀具的切削深度。
c. 切削循环:使用G33指令开始循环切削,编程时需要指定循环切削的半径、方向和次数。
d. 切削完成:循环切削完成后,使用G00指令将刀具移动到安全位置。
4. 编写循环切削的返回路径:循环切削完成后,需要将刀具移动到循环切削的起点位置,以便进行下一次循环切削。在编程时,可以使用G98或G99指令来设置返回路径。G98指令表示返回到循环切削的起点;G99指令表示返回到循环切削的终点。
以下是一个G33编程的示例代码:
```
N10 G90 G17 G98
N20 G00 X100.0 Z100.0
N30 G43 H01 Z10.0
N40 G33 X100.0 Z50.0 R10.0 F100.0
N50 G00 Z100.0
N60 G53 H01
N70 G00 X0 Y0
```
在这个示例中,N10至N70为G33编程的完整过程。设置绝对编程模式和选择XY平面;然后,将刀具移动到循环切削的起点位置;接着,设置刀具的切削深度和循环切削的半径;开始循环切削,并在循环切削完成后将刀具移动到安全位置。
数控车床G33编程需要精确设置循环切削的起点、终点、半径和路径。通过合理编程,可以提高加工效率和精度,从而满足客户对高质量产品的需求。在实际操作中,应根据具体情况进行调整和优化,以达到最佳加工效果。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。